Indian government's attitude towards online board game
2023-04-24 11:24:39

With the development of India’s economy and the popularity of smart phones, the market scale of its online game industry is getting bigger than before. According to some statistics, in 2020, the scale of Indian’s game market is about 1.1 billion dollars, and the user scale is about 350 million. Facing the huge market, more and more operators promote game in India. For chess and card games, the policy requirements of the Indian government cannot be generalized. Therefore, it is extremely necessary to find out the relevant policy regulations of chess and card games in different regions of India in order to reduce the error rate.





Some online board & card game In India



In India, board and card games can also be divided into skill and probability games, such as Rummy and Teen Patti. Probabilistic games have randomness and a certain element of luck; Skill game refers to the player skills to win the advantage of greater than probability advantage, is a technical content of the game. Games of chance are generally banned under the laws of the central government of India, and gambling is a game of chance, so not all real money game in India are legal.

Each state in India has its own specific laws, so the laws promulgated by the central government of India do not necessarily apply to other parts: not all games of chance are banned and not all skill games are allowed in each region of India. So knowing which areas allow games of chance and which do not allow games of skill is a good guide for board and card games publishment in India.





Different control policies across states



1. Game of chance

Probability games are banned in most states, but they are legal in Goa and Sikkim ( need require a license to publish them ). Both the governments have issued regulations and brought in game industry experts, the policy will be revised periodically.

Requirements for license:



1. Applicants must be individuals from Indian nationality or independent corporate entities registered in India;

2. Applicants must not have any criminal record;

3. The controlling interest and decision-making power of the applicant must be located in India;



2. Skill game

Such games are allowed in most states and do not require any licenses. This means that game companies can not only offer these games, but also legally promote them through various social media, television and websites. For example, in 2016, Galand promulgated the online game law, which stipulates that gambling is prohibited in Galand, but skill-based online games are allowed. Although they have the probability factor, they are still dominated by skills (including the Rummy game).



3. Game-banned states

① The states of Orissa and Assam have enacted a law banning skill-based games;

② In Maharashtra and Mumbai, gambling laws define online gaming (whether of skill or chance) as a prohibited offence;

③ Telangana has passed the Telangana Gaming (Amendment) Regulations 2017 and Telangana Gaming (Second Amendment) Regulations 2017 to ban all online and offline gambling activities;

volving regulations for online gaming in India



As the Indian government has begun to pay more attention to the legality of funds and taxation in the online games industry, it has taken “skill advantage” as the most important criterion for the legality of online games. It is certain that as the Indian online gaming industry grows, the relevant laws and regulations will be updated and changed gradually.
